Yacht rental in Baku starts from 150 AZN per hour for a sailing yacht or 550 AZN per hour for a motor yacht. The final price depends on four parameters: yacht type, duration, season, and day of the week. In this guide — ballpark rates for 2026, no hidden fees and no asterisks in fine print.
Important: the prices below are approximate references. The exact amount for your scenario is calculated in the calculator — it takes into account the specific yacht, date, duration, and season.
What affects the price
1. Yacht type
A sailing yacht is cheaper than a motor yacht, typically by 1.5–2 times. This is due to different operating economics: a sailing yacht doesn't need as much fuel — there's an engine, but it runs less often, with the sail being the main driving force.
2. Duration
The more hours you book, the cheaper each subsequent hour gets. On a sailing yacht, after the 5th hour the rate drops from 200 to 150 AZN/h. On a motor yacht — after the 4th hour from 250 to 150 AZN/h.
This works both ways: a 1-hour "hourly" booking is the most expensive format. If you can take the yacht for at least 3 hours — it works out cheaper per hour.
3. Season
The year breaks into three periods:
- High season (May–September) — stable operations, warm sea, active schedule
- Shoulder (October–December, April) — plenty of good weather windows for outings, prices 20–30% lower, but dates need to be agreed in advance. There have even been winter departures — we've spent New Year's Eve on the water more than once.
- Cold season (January–March) — too cold and windy, rare departures, by individual request only
The tables below show rates for high and low season sailing yachts. The shoulder season falls under the low tariffs. Motor yachts — no seasonal breakdown, the price stays the same year-round.
4. Day of the week
Weekday and weekend prices are the same.
Sailing yacht prices in 2026
Sailing yachts in Baku — from 150 to 300 AZN for the first hour (high season, May–September). The difference is in the yacht itself:
- Budget option — a simple sailing yacht without special amenities. From 150 AZN per hour.
- Standard / premium (for example, the Beneteau Oceanis 411 "Alora") — from 200 AZN per hour.
Cumulative pricing principle: the first hour at the higher rate, each subsequent hour cheaper. After the 5th hour the rate drops noticeably. 6 hours is 9% cheaper per hour than 5 hours, and 9 hours is another 10% cheaper per hour than 6 hours.
Typical scenarios on a standard yacht:
- 3 hours ~ 700 AZN
- Full day with swimming (6 h) ~ 1,250 AZN
- All day (9 h) ~ 1,700 AZN
On a budget yacht, prices are 30–40% lower. In the shoulder and cold seasons (October–April), prices drop by another 20–30%, departures by prior arrangement.
Motor yacht prices in 2026
Motor yacht outings — no seasonal breakdown, the price is the same year-round:
- 1 hour ~ 550 AZN
- 3 hours ~ 1,050 AZN
- 5 hours ~ 1,350 AZN
- 9 hours ~ 1,800 AZN
The calculation is the same — cumulative by hour. On a motor yacht, the "sweet spot" starts at 3 hours: after that, the rate drops noticeably, and each subsequent hour becomes more attractive.

What's included in the price
The rental price typically already includes:
- ✅ Experienced crew — captain and deckhand with years of experience on the Caspian, languages RU/EN/AZ
- ✅ Fuel for a typical route of up to 3 hours (beyond that — by actual consumption)
- ✅ Drinking water on board
- ✅ Safety equipment to safety standards (life jackets, emergency kits)
- ✅ Mooring and marina fees
On cheap aggregators, the captain and fuel are often charged separately, and the final price ends up higher.
What's NOT included and is paid separately
- ❌ Catering and alcohol — ordered separately or bring your own
- ❌ Deposit — usually none
- ❌ Date rescheduling — free in case of a storm warning, paid if cancelled from your side
Special case — bareboat charter
If you want to skipper the yacht yourself, without a permanent captain — this service is not available in Baku (specifics of the local waters and legal status).
Bareboat is available in places with developed charter infrastructure — Croatia, Greece, Turkey. If you're interested:

How to save on rental
- Book more hours. On a sailing yacht, 6 hours = 1,250 AZN versus 5 hours = 1,100 AZN — an extra 150 AZN for one more hour, against the fact that the 6th hour would otherwise cost the "short" rate of 200 AZN.
- Low season. If the weather permits (warm October–April happens), prices are 30% lower.
- Group of 6–8 people. On a motor yacht, that's optimal capacity. Split the bill with friends: for 8 people, it works out to about 150 AZN per person for a 5-hour rental.
